19. Powers of inspection.- (1) For the purpose of ascertaining the position of working of any industrial undertaking or for any other purpose mentioned in this Act or the rules made thereunder, any person authorised by the Central Government in this behalf shall have the right-

(a) to enter and inspect any premises;

(b) to order the production of any document, book, register or record in the possession or power of any person having the control of, or employed in connection with, any industrial undertaking; and

(c) to examine any person having the control of, or employed in connection with, any industrial undertaking.

(2) Any person authorised by the Central Government under sub-section (1) shall be deemed to be a public servant within the meaning of Section 21 of the Indian Penal Code (45 of 1860).
